What is Alpine Select AG PEG Ratio?

PE Ratio without NRI / 5-Year Book Value Growth Rate*

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use for banks is the 5-Year Book Value growth rate. As of today, Alpine Select AG's PE Ratio without NRI is 0.00. Alpine Select AG's 5-Year Book Value growth rate is -9.00%. Therefore, Alpine Select AG's PEG Ratio for today is N/A.

* The 5-Year Book Value Growth Rate is the 5-year average Book Value per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

Alpine Select AG  (XSWX:ALPN)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Alpine Select AG is an investment company that offers institutional and individual investors the key benefit of investing into a diversified alternative investment portfolio with core investment strategies: discount-, risk-arbitrage, tactical exploitation of under-researched companies/situations, short-term opportunities, liquid hedge funds and digital assets. The company's objective is to obtain capital appreciation from investments in core investment strategies: discount-, risk-arbitrage, tactical exploitation of under-researched companies/situations, short term opportunities, liquid hedge funds and digital assets.
